econ-review
Professores do ensino superior, todos os outros

Review economics papers, working papers, theses, and submissions with referee-grade rigor and exhaustive verified comments. Use when the user asks to evaluate, referee, audit, stress-test, pre-review, find all problems, or comprehensively review empirical, experimental, descriptive, forecasting, prediction/ML, historical, archival, qualitative, meta-analytic, structural, quantitative, macro, theoretical, or mixed economics work; assess identification, inference, logic, equations, evidence, novelty, clarity, or journal readiness; or produce a grounded referee report, separate editing comments, optional requested journal-fit analysis, findings ledger, and prioritized fix plan. Use econ-review to judge papers; use econ-write to draft or rewrite paper text after the judgment is settled.

econ-review-setup
Desenvolvedores de software

Prepare, verify, repair, or refresh the user-owned Python runtime and local Review Desk used by an installed econ-review plugin. Use when the user installs econ-review from a marketplace, asks to finish setup, reports missing Python packages or Poppler, needs the Review Desk launcher, or wants to check installation readiness without creating duplicate Claude Code or Codex skill copies.
